My Trackimo got wet the other day, (it still works), but to be safe charging the small Li-ion battery, I thought I'd get the battery replaced. However I'm having a hard time finding one to buy online. Trackimo has yet to respond. It looks to be a generic model branded by Trackimo, I'm guessing it's from a cellphone.

Anyone know of an equivalent model battery?
The battery specs:
Model: TRKM002
Voltage: 3.7
Capacity: 600mAh/2.22Wh
Charging Voltage: 4.2
Standard: GB/T 18287-2013

Finally spoke to Trackimo today, just an FYI for anyone who wants to replace their Trackimo battery, TRKM002,
Trackimo says none are available and they will not sell you one. They also claim it is a custom model (smaller size, 600ma), and not available from online sources such as eBay, AliBaba, Amazon etc. I also was unable to find a similar one searching online.

Their "solution" was to sell me a brand new Trackimo (2G & 3G model) at full website price… I said I'd think about it…
I was not impressed at all. I thought the offer was not much of a deal; even though they were aware I had just purchased my Trackimo only 3 months ago.

I haven not tried the Trackimo, so I guess I should not have said that. The GPS trackers I have tried needed to have the GPS module facing the sky, so if I laid it on the ground facing down, it would not get a signal or send its current location. So in a crash, the craft would need to stop at a position with the tracker facing up to the sky. Although it would still send out cellular data, it is triangulated from nearby towers, which gave me a two to three city block radius as to were it crashed. Just my two cents.

Lipos are sealed so no air gets in. Water should not be able to get inside either. Unless you got corrosion on the contacts battery should be OK once you dried it.
I use tk 102 from bang good.com - works great though initialy difficult to set. Once you get it set it works in real time tracking trough Internet platform or you can call the device and get sms with current position as a link to Google maps.
